We are looking to recruit an EV Charging Maintenance Electrician to join our expanding Electric Vehicle charging business unit. The role involves maintaining electric vehicle charging infrastructure across sites in the UK. The ideal candidate will have previous EV charging maintenance experience and be willing to travel to different sites daily. Some overnight stays may be required, but most nights will be at home.
Benefits include: JIB rates, a company vehicle, and additional benefits.
You will be field-based, visiting client sites to maintain EV charging equipment (mostly DC chargers). Your responsibilities include ensuring work is completed safely and tidily, and that customers understand the work done.
Weekend work is optional, and overtime is available on weekdays.
